Extreme Diet–Related Syncope in a Young Adult: The Diagnostic Value of Comprehensive Nutritional Assessment in Primary Care
Sila ALTUNTAS, Onur EMRE, Ilgin IMIR, Vildan MEVSIM and Buse HAZINEDAROĞLU
Extremely restrictive diets among young adults—often influenced by social media—can cause acute metabolic instability. Symptoms may appear nonspecific, and individuals may attend routine visits rather than present with clear complaints. In primary care, detailed nutritional history is essential to identify high-risk dietary patterns and prevent serious outcomes. Lifestyle-focused assessment helps contextualize subtle presentations and supports early intervention.A 23-year-old woman visited a family health center for routine weight monitoring and laboratory evaluation. She reported following a “water diet” for one month, consuming 1–1.5 liters of water and occasional low-calorie liquids, with nearly no solid food. She experienced rapid weight loss (7–9 kg/month), palpitations, fatigue, cold extremities, and menstrual delay. Shortly after leaving the examination room, she developed sudden dizziness and brief loss of consciousness. Reassessment showed hypotension (85/55 mmHg), tachycardia (112 bpm), reduced skin turgor, and capillary glucose of 59 mg/dL. She improved quickly with positioning and oral glucose. Suspecting metabolic disturbance, she was urgently referred for testing. Laboratory results revealed mild hypoglycemia, electrolyte imbalance, ketonuria consistent with starvation ketosis, mild metabolic acidosis, and low ferritin with mild anemia. At follow-up, the metabolic consequences of extreme caloric restriction were explained. Motivational interviewing addressed her weight-loss motives and psychosocial influences. A gradual caloric restoration plan, hydration guidance, healthy plate education, and counseling on safe weight management were provided.Although restrictive dieting is common, this case demonstrates syncope directly linked to a social-media-driven diet trend, emphasizing the ability of primary care to identify metabolic crises through lifestyle-focused assessment.Young adults may adopt extreme diets without recognizing risks. Early lifestyle-oriented questioning can prevent severe metabolic consequences and reduce emergency visits. Structured nutrition screening in routine assessments may help counter unsafe diet trends.The patient’s syncope was explained by caloric deprivation, ketosis, and hypoglycemia. Evidence supports motivational interviewing and gradual caloric reintroduction as effective first-line strategies.Extreme dieting can cause acute metabolic instability and syncope. Comprehensive nutritional assessment and patient-centered counseling in primary care enable timely recognition and safer recovery.
